HRSA’s budget for the 2009-11 biennium as proposed by Governor Gregoire on December 18, 2008, totals $10.4 billion – 53.9 percent of the total DSHS budget of $19.3 billion.

An HRSA analysis of the Governor’s budget is available to HRSA stakeholders.

The Governor’s budget is the first real milestone in the development of the 2009-11 state budget. Legislators will come together on both House and Senate versions of the budget package before consolidating them in a final Conference budget.

That budget then must be signed by the Governor before taking effect.

Governor Gregoire also released a Supplemental Budget for state government on December 18, 2008. The Supplement budget covers the remaining months (January through June 2009) left in the current fiscal year. The Supplemental Budget follows the same process in the Legislature. HRSA’s 2007-09 Budget

HRSA’s budget for the 2007-09 biennium totals $10.2 billion – 51.8 percent of the total DSHS budget of $19.7 billion.
